Abstract:
A halogen-free, flame retardant composition comprises thermoplastic polyurethane, olefin block copolymer, carbonyl-containing olefin polymer compatibilizer, and flame retardant package comprising bisphenol-A bis(diphenyl phosphate) and/or resorcinol bis(diphenyl phosphate), a nitrogen/phosphorus based, halogen-free flame retardant, and epoxidized novolac. The composition that will not only be processed easily to make a wire or cable sheath but also pass both the VW-1 flame retardancy test and the UL1581 heat deformation test at 150° C. exhibits good tensile and flexibility properties.
Abstract:
Methods for presenting files upon switching between system states and portable terminals are provided. The portable terminal comprising a first system platform and a second system platform, a state in which the presentation of the file is controlled by the first system platform being a first state, and a state in which the presentation of the file is controlled by the second system platform being a second state. The method comprising: detecting, by the first system platform in the first state, that a status of the file satisfies a preset condition; backuping, by the first system platform, the file for the second system platform; and switching to the second state, and continuing, by the second system platform, the presentation of the file based on the backup file. With the portable terminal of hybrid system architecture according to embodiments of the present invention, if the system state is switched while a file is being played, the switched-to system can continue presenting the file based on the backup file, according to the presentation progress before the system switching. In this way, it is possible to achieve a seamless presentation of the file before and after the switching, and thus improve user's experience.
